LRT passengers trapped as LRT doors fail to open

Ramil Bajo, Rey Galupo - The Philippine Star

MANILA, Philippines – Panic-stricken passengers of the Light Rail Transit Line 1 (LRT-1) complained of trouble breathing and heat exhaustion after the train doors failed to open at the Central Station in Plaza Lawton, Manila yesterday morning.

A video of the commotion and hysterical passengers went viral in social media yesterday as soon as it was posted by a passenger, gaining close to 100,000 views and various negative comments regarding the LRT system.

The over two-minute video uploaded by Kurt Ebol showed irate passengers trying to forcibly open the doors that were stuck when the train arrived at the Central Station.

In his comment, Ebol said the train’s operator advised the passengers to just open the windows to let air in.

Earlier, a video taken by some students showed a Metro Rail Transit (MRT) train running with its door open. The MRT operates along the stretch of EDSA.

Ebol said some of the passengers reportedly tried to use the emergency lever but it also failed to open the door.

After a short time the door of the first coach opened and passengers hurriedly exited the train.

According to the LRT management, the train lost traction and this affected the control of the doors.
